Verification Guide

Each instrument emits a certificate file (CBOR) with code hashes and witnesses. Use the verify CLI in the repo to re-run the proof.

Certificate Format

All proofs ship with a standardized certificate bundle containing:

  • • Code hash (SHA-256 of the proof algorithm)
  • • Input parameters and witness data
  • • Verification timestamp and metadata
  • • Digital signature for authenticity

Verification Process

1. Download the certificate bundle from the project repository

2. Run the verification tool with the certificate as input

3. The tool will reproduce the proof computation and verify the result

4. Compare the computed hash with the certificate hash

Reproducibility

Every proof is designed to be bit-for-bit reproducible. The same input parameters will always produce the same output hash, ensuring complete verifiability and preventing any possibility of manipulation or error.
